Comparison Overview

Picking between the refined luxury of the 2025 Lexus RX and the frugal practicality of the 2025 Toyota RAV4 Hybrid is a classic dilemma: do you prioritize comfort or cost savings? The price gap is substantial, with the RX starting at $49,125 compared to the RAV4 Hybrid’s $32,850, meaning you pay a premium for the Lexus badge and refinement. Power delivery also varies significantly; the RX boasts 275 hp while the RAV4 Hybrid offers a more modest 219 hp. However, the trade-off for that power is fuel economy: the RAV4 Hybrid achieves an excellent 39 MPG combined, whereas the RX sips premium fuel for just 25 MPG combined. While the RX is physically larger at 192.5 inches long, the smaller RAV4 surprisingly offers more usable space with 37.6 cu ft of cargo capacity versus the RX's 29.6 cu ft.

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about comparing the 2025 Lexus RX and 2025 Toyota RAV4 Hybrid.

What is the primary cost difference between the 2025 Lexus RX and the 2025 RAV4 Hybrid?

The 2025 Lexus RX starts at a significantly higher MSRP of $49,125, while the 2025 Toyota RAV4 Hybrid has a base price of just $32,850. This results in an immediate price gap of $16,275 favoring the Toyota.

How much more fuel-efficient is the RAV4 Hybrid compared to the Lexus RX?

The RAV4 Hybrid is dramatically more efficient, achieving 39 MPG combined on regular unleaded fuel. The Lexus RX, running on premium fuel, manages only 25 MPG combined.

Which vehicle offers better hauling capability for groceries or gear?

Surprisingly, the smaller Toyota RAV4 Hybrid is the winner here, offering 37.6 cubic feet of cargo capacity. The larger Lexus RX provides only 29.6 cubic feet behind its rear seats.

Is the Lexus RX much more powerful than the RAV4 Hybrid?

Yes, the Lexus RX produces 275 horsepower and 317 lb-ft of torque, giving it 56 more horsepower than the 219 hp generated by the RAV4 Hybrid system.

Do I need to use premium gasoline in either crossover?

The 2025 Lexus RX recommends premium unleaded fuel for its operation. Conversely, the 2025 Toyota RAV4 Hybrid is designed to run efficiently on regular unleaded gasoline, saving on every fill-up.

Which vehicle comes standard with All-Wheel Drive?

The 2025 Toyota RAV4 Hybrid comes standard with an All-Wheel Drive (AWD) system. The base 2025 Lexus RX is listed with Front Wheel Drive (FWD).
